What is the how to edit office 365 signature
The "how to edit Office 365 signature" refers to the process of modifying your email signature within the Office 365 platform. This signature is an essential part of professional communication, as it often includes your name, title, company, and contact information. Editing your signature allows you to ensure that all outgoing emails reflect your current role and provide recipients with accurate information.
Steps to complete the how to edit office 365 signature
To edit your Office 365 signature, follow these steps:
- Log in to your Office 365 account.
- Navigate to the Outlook application.
- Click on the gear icon in the upper right corner to access Settings.
- Select "View all Outlook settings."
- In the Mail section, choose "Compose and reply."
- In the Email signature box, make your desired changes.
- Save your changes before exiting the settings menu.
This process ensures that your email signature is updated and displayed in all outgoing messages, enhancing your professional image.
Key elements of the how to edit office 365 signature
When editing your Office 365 signature, consider including the following key elements:
- Name: Your full name should be prominently displayed.
- Title: Include your job title to clarify your role.
- Company: Mention your company's name for brand recognition.
- Contact Information: Provide your phone number and email address for easy communication.
- Social Media Links: Optionally, add links to professional social media profiles.
These elements contribute to a comprehensive and professional email signature that represents you and your organization effectively.
